08.02.2025 — Релиз PuTTY 0.83
Основные изменения:
- Поддержка
ML-KEM— стандартизированного NIST постквантового механизма обмена ключами. (В дополнение к NTRU Prime, поддерживаемому начиная с версии 0.78.) - Поддержка полных Unicode-имен файлов в диалогах выбора файлов Windows. (Однако в конфигурации сеанса такие имена пока не сохраняются.)
Другие изменения:
- В Unix-сборках на процессорах ARM включена установка флага
PSTATE.DIT(Data-Independent Timing) для защиты криптографических операций с постоянным временем выполнения. - В GTK/Unix-сборках шрифт по умолчанию изменен на клиентский
client:Monospace 12, что обеспечивает работоспособность в Wayland-окружениях. Добавлен механизм резервных шрифтов при недоступности настроенного шрифта. - В GTK-версии pterm исправлена установка переменной
DISPLAYв среде Wayland.
Исправления ошибок:
- Команда
psftp -b(пакетные файлы) снова работает. - Исправлен сбой «assertion failure» при разрыве SSH-соединения по таймауту при запросе на вход.
- Исправлен сбой Pageant при закрытии SSH-соединения в процессе ожидания ввода парольной фразы для отложенной расшифровки ключа.
- Отправка пустого ответа на
^E(answerback) приводила к зацикливанию. - Исправлено случайное обрезание содержимого некоторых полей конфигурации до 127 символов.
- Поддержка Windows XP была случайно нарушена и теперь восстановлена.
- Восстановлена совместимость со сторонними инструментами, автоматически заполняющими запросы на вход отправкой
^Mвместо Return./li> - Исправлена некорректная обработка изменения размера окна внешними инструментами, такими как FancyZones.
- Клавиши навигационного блока могли не работать в терминале на Unix.
- Протокол SUPDUP: операция
TDCRLтеперь очищает новую строку при переводе курсора.